如何访问搜索 LookupFields 结果

How to access the search LookupFields result

下面是我的搜索代码。我正在使用发票内部 ID 搜索发票编号。

访问 lookupFields 搜索结果的正确方法是什么?

var invoiceNumber = fieldLookUp.value;

我正在使用上面的行,但是“invoiceNumber”是空的。感谢您的帮助。

var fieldLookUp = search.lookupFields({
                    type: search.Type.INVOICE,
                    id: invoiceId,
                    columns: 'tranid'
                });

                var invoiceNumber = fieldLookUp.value;

它只是 fieldLookUp.tranidlookupFields returns 一个对象,其中对象的键是您的列,对象的值是列值。

观看此视频了解有关 SS2.0 中字段查找的更多详细信息:https://www.youtube.com/watch?v=_fs2thUdEmQ

如果只想获取值

fieldLookUp[0].value

反之亦然,如果你想获取文本数据

fieldLookUp[0].text